    Fion

    I'm using an Access table and "purchaseDate" is of Date/Time data type. I wish to retrieve and display records sorted by Date using the sql statement below, but it does not seem to work. It seems to give me records that are last accessed followed by others which are least accessed.

function GetPurchase
dim sql,rs
set rs = Server.CreateObject("ADODB.RecordSet")

sql = "Select o_id as ""Purchase id"",purchaseDate as ""Date Initiated"", p_title as ""Project title"",totalAmt as ""Total Amount"", status as ""Current Status"" from purchase where staff_id = '"+user+"' order by purchaseDate"
rs.open sql,dbConn
set GetPurchase = rs
end function

I really need to order the records by the purchaseDate. Please enlighten or advise.
Thanks

    you could try:
"order by purchaseDate desc;"

